Why screw-in handle spinning reels need to enhance stability

Screw-in handle spinning reels need to enhance stability for several important reasons, all of which contribute to the overall functionality and effectiveness of the reel in various fishing situations:
Control During Fish Fights: When an angler hooks into a fish, especially one that is strong and determined to escape, maintaining control is crucial. A stable handle ensures that every turn of the handle corresponds directly to the rotation of the spool, allowing the angler to exert precise and consistent pressure on the fish. This control helps tire out the fish more efficiently and prevents it from breaking the line or escaping.
Reduced Fatigue: Fishing can involve hours of casting and retrieving, which can be physically demanding. A stable handle minimizes hand and wrist fatigue by providing a smooth and consistent reeling motion. Anglers can reel in their line with less effort and for longer periods without experiencing discomfort or strain.
Line Management: Proper line management is essential to prevent line twists and tangles. A stable handle ensures that the line is spooled onto the reel evenly and without any wobble. This contributes to better line management, reducing the chances of frustrating line issues that can disrupt the fishing experience.
Smooth Casting and Retrieval: Stability during casting and retrieval is vital for accuracy and efficiency. A wobbly handle can result in uneven casting, leading to inaccurate placement of baits or lures. During retrieval, a stable handle ensures that the line is wound onto the spool evenly, preventing friction and improving casting distance and accuracy.
Hooksets and Fish Landing: When setting the hook and subsequently reeling in the fish, a stable handle plays a crucial role. It allows for a smooth and controlled motion, ensuring that the hook is firmly set in the fish's mouth and that the fish is brought in without sudden jerks or surges. This reduces the risk of losing the fish due to a poorly executed hookset or reel action.
Line Strength and Integrity: Excessive wobbling or instability can place undue stress on the fishing line, potentially leading to line breakage or damage. A stable handle helps maintain consistent tension on the line, preventing sudden shocks and preserving the integrity of the line.
